Cardiff Park Advisors LLC lowered its stake in Dimensional US Marketwide Value ETF (NYSEARCA:DFUV – Free Report) by 5.8% during the first qu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 641,341 shares of the company’s stock after selling 39,251 shares during the period. Dimensional US Marketwide Value ETF comprises 2.5% of Cardiff Park Advisors L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 8th biggest position. Cardiff Park Advisors LLC’s holdings in Dimensional US Marketwide Value ETF were worth $31,079,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Dimensional US Marketwide Value ETF Company Profile
The Dimensional US Marketwide Value ETF (DFUV)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the Russell 3000 Value index. The fund is an actively managed portfolio of US stocks, selected for having value characteristics. The fund seeks to provide long-term capital appreciation. DFUV was launched on Dec 16, 1998 and is managed by Dimensional.
